The Daily Numbers: 1 part-time Darby Borough police officer shot and killed in his Darby Township home.

1 person being questioned in the shooting. No charges have yet been filed.

3 years, how long Mark Hudson had been on the borough police force. He also was active with Yeadon Fire Co.

1,57 million dollars, how much Rose Tree Media School District plans to spend to renovate the Penncrest High School athletic fields, including a new synthetic field and $400,000 for a new track.

400 events a year that could be held on the synthetic surface, as opposed to 40 on the natural grass.
